Dpark:高效的分布式数据处理框架

Dpark 是一款高性能的分布式数据处理框架,支持大规模数据处理、数据流处理和高性能计算。了解如何使用 Dpark 来处理大数据,并充分利用其分布式计算能力。
clickgpt_line.png_noView
介绍

Dpark 是一个开源的分布式数据处理框架,专为大规模数据集的处理而设计。它基于 Python 编程语言构建,提供了高度并行化的数据处理能力,适用于处理各种数据工作负载,包括批处理、数据清洗、数据转换和分析等任务。Dpark 的设计灵感来自于 Apache Spark,但它在Python生态系统中更加紧密集成,使得用户可以更轻松地处理大数据。

功能

高性能数据处理

Dpark 通过并行化和分布式计算,可以高效地处理大规模数据集。它支持内存计算,以加速数据处理过程,并提供了丰富的数据转换和操作功能。

分布式计算

Dpark 支持分布式计算,允许用户在集群上运行任务,从而提高了数据处理的速度和容量。

数据流处理

Dpark 提供了数据流处理的功能,使得用户可以处理实时数据流,并执行实时分析和操作。

多语言支持

Dpark 不仅支持 Python,还支持其他编程语言,如 Java 和 Scala,从而扩大了用户的选择范围。

优势

  • 高性能:Dpark 通过并行化和内存计算实现了卓越的性能,适用于处理大数据集。
  • 易于使用:Dpark 的 Python 集成和简单的API设计使其易于上手,无需深厚的分布式计算经验。
  • 灵活性:用户可以根据自己的需求定制数据处理任务,并利用分布式计算来扩展处理能力。

使用方法

使用 Dpark 需要配置一个分布式集群环境,并安装 Dpark 库。然后,用户可以编写数据处理任务的代码,包括数据提取、转换和操作。最后,任务可以提交到集群上运行。Dpark 提供了详细的文档和示例,以帮助用户入门。

总之,Dpark 是一款高性能的分布式数据处理框架,适用于处理大规模数据集。无论您是数据工程师、数据分析师还是科学家,Dpark 都可以帮助您充分利用大数据,进行高效的数据处理和分析。

编程学习
编程学习 免费领取编程学习资料 进编程学习交流群
订阅号
视频号
公众号 关注公众号,回复关键字java领取大厂最新面试题
×
编程学习
免费领取编程学习资料 进编程学习交流群